Doris Nicoletti, of Cochecton, NY, passed away on Thursday March 10, 2016 at Roscoe Regional Rehab and RHCF. She was 89. Born on December 27, 1926 in Lancaster, PA, she was the daughter of the late Robert and Hilda Kellenberger and was one of 12 children. Doris was a Registered Nurse and retired from Hamilton Ave. Hospital in Monticello, NY.

Survivors include her seven sons, Michael of Hampton, VA, Thomas (Nancy) of Cochecton, NY, Phillip of Fosterdale, NY, Robert of Callicoon, NY, William (Kim) of Hampton, VA, Joseph Nicoletti (Jackie) of Westtown, NY and James (Elizabeth) of Cochecton, NY; grandchildren, Mark, Timothy, Phillip, Amelia, Laura, Regina, Michael, Sarah, Anthony, Elizabeth, Heather, Erica, Courtney, Lindsay, Ashley, Kevin, Matthew and Theresa and great-grandchildren, Michael, Aden, Noah and Brianna. She is also survived by her brothers, Richard, Harry, Fred, James, Edwin and George and a sister, Eleanor. She was predeceased by her husband, Salvatore Nicoletti; brothers, John and William; sisters, Ruth and Patricia and two grandchildren, Michele and A.J. Nicoletti.
